Trump escalates Brazil standoff by revoking ambassador’s U.S. visa
- The Trump administration has revoked the visa of Brazil's ambassador to Washington, sharply escalating a diplomatic dispute after Brazil delayed approval of the president's nominee for U.
- ambassador and denied visas to two American diplomats.
- A senior State Department official said Ambassador Maria Luiza Ribeiro Viotti's visa was canceled as a reciprocal measure, but stressed she was not being expelled from the United States.
